Australia appoints Mitchell Marsh, Josh Hazlewood as vice-captains

Cricket Australia pulled up a surprise by announcing all-round Mitchell Marsh and fast bowler Josh Hazlewood as Test side deputies to Tim Paine. They were picked by national coach, Justin Langer after a lengthy selection process. Hazlewood becomes only the third specialist bowler to become vice-captain for Australia whereas Mitchell Marsh follows his father, Geoff Marsh’s footsteps. Geoff Marsh was Test vice-captain Under Allan Border for Australia.

There were reports that the uncapped players who got their maiden test call up like Aaron Finch, Travis Head and Alex Carey were other players in contention for the vice-captaincy post. The selection process approach was a poll from Australian current players, which were presented to a panel headed by Langer and former Test captains Greg Chappell and Mark Taylor and some other members from Board and chief selector Trevor Hohns.
